Course structure

• Fundamentals of Contract Management
• Legal Aspects of Contracting
• Risk Management in Contracts
• Procurement Strategies and Negotiation
• Contract Administration and Compliance
• Cost Estimation and Financial Analysis
• Ethical Practices in Contract Management
• Advanced Contract Writing and Documentation
• Dispute Resolution and Conflict Management
• Technology and Tools for Contract Management

Career Opportunities in Contract Management

Role Description
Contract Manager Oversee the creation, negotiation, and execution of contracts, ensuring compliance with legal and organizational standards.
Procurement Specialist Manage the acquisition of goods and services, ensuring cost-effectiveness and adherence to contractual terms.
Compliance Officer Monitor and enforce adherence to contractual obligations, regulations, and industry standards.
Supply Chain Analyst Analyze and optimize supply chain processes, including contract negotiations and vendor management.
Project Manager Coordinate project timelines, budgets, and resources while managing contractual agreements with stakeholders.
Vendor Manager Develop and maintain relationships with vendors, ensuring contracts align with organizational goals.
Legal Contract Advisor Provide expert advice on contract terms, risks, and legal implications to ensure organizational protection.
